I just finished watching FLCL. What an utterly odd anime. Not bad by any means, just...weird. The only thing I don't like is all the loose ends. There are too many plotlines that aren't quite tied up properly I think. Then again, that's the way of a Gainax anime, isn't it? Always looking to confuse the viewer and make him/her question the story. It kind of makes me wonder what the manga is like. The anime is so fast-paced, both with its story and imagery that I wonder how they put it into manga. You know, though, I probably wouldn't have initially known it was Gainax had I not seen the logo in the intro parts. However, when you examine the plot elements, it's easier to see that. For example, the whole animated manga part in the first episode is something that I mentally linked with Kare Kano when I saw it because that anime had a motion-manga part in it as well. Also, subways, telephone poles, bridges, et cetera, are all things that appear frequently in Gainax anime. This was true for FLCL as well. What probably would have thrown me the most was the animation. It reminds me of Kare Kano except much smoother and...well...digitized, I guess. I probably wouldn't have linked Fooly Cooly with Neon Genesis Evangelion on the simple basis that the humor was much wilder than what Eva ever had. However, FLCL was pretty well on par with Kare Kano in that department, but even crazier. Overall, I think FLCL is a pretty good anime, but it's definitely not one of my favorites. As far as AMVs go, it really demands comedy, so I'm not sure that I'll ever make a video with it. An action/comedy, MAYBE, but probably never a true comedy.
